What is the Prime Minister Laptop Scheme 2025?

The Prime Minister Laptop Scheme is a government-funded initiative aimed at providing free laptops to deserving students, helping them enhance their educational experience through the use of modern technology. The scheme is open to students from various academic backgrounds, and in 2025, it has been expanded to include more participants from all corners of Pakistan. This effort supports the government’s vision to digitalize education and make learning more accessible.

PM Laptop Scheme Online Registration Process

The online registration process for the Prime Minister Laptop Scheme 2025 is quite simple. However, students must ensure that they meet all the eligibility criteria to avoid any issues during the application process. Below is a step-by-step guide to help you apply for the scheme.

Step 1: Visit the Official Portal

  • The first step is to visit the official Prime Minister Laptop Scheme website. This is where you will find the registration form and other essential details. Make sure you are on the authentic site to avoid scams.

Step 2: Create an Account

  • Once on the website, you will need to create an account using your valid CNIC number or B-Form (for underage applicants). This account will be used for tracking your application and laptop distribution process.

Step 3: Fill in the Application Form

  • After registering, you will need to fill in the online application form. The form will ask for your personal details, academic background, and contact information. Ensure that you enter all details correctly to avoid delays or rejections.

Step 4: Submit Required Documents

During the application, you may need to upload some documents for verification purposes. These may include:

  • CNIC or B-Form (for minors)
  • Academic transcripts or certificates
  • Enrollment confirmation from the institution (for enrolled students)

Step 5: Confirm Submission

  • After completing the form and uploading the necessary documents, double-check the information provided. Once you are sure everything is accurate, submit your application.

Step 6: Wait for the Results

  • After submission, the system will verify your eligibility. If successful, you will be notified via SMS or email about the status of your application. Make sure to check your notifications regularly.

Educational Requirements for the Prime Minister Laptop Scheme 2025

The Prime Minister Laptop Scheme 2025 is primarily targeted at students who meet certain academic criteria. Below are the specific educational requirements:

Eligibility for Undergraduate Students

  • Program: Students enrolled in undergraduate programs (including bachelor’s degrees) at recognized universities and institutions.
  • CGPA Requirement: A minimum CGPA of 2.5 or above is generally required. However, specific institutions may have additional requirements.
  • Enrollment Status: Applicants must be currently enrolled in a full-time undergraduate program.

Eligibility for Graduate and Postgraduate Students

  • Program: Graduate (Master’s) and postgraduate (M.Phil/Ph.D.) students from recognized institutions are eligible.
  • CGPA Requirement: A minimum CGPA of 3.0 or above for postgraduate students is often a requirement.
  • Enrollment Status: Full-time enrollment in a graduate or postgraduate program is mandatory.

Special Criteria for Students with Disabilities

The scheme also has provisions for students with disabilities. They are encouraged to apply, and special consideration is given to their needs during the selection process.

Final Year Students

In some cases, final-year students who have a minimum CGPA of 2.5 (for undergraduates) or 3.0 (for postgraduates) can also apply for the laptop scheme.
